Patrick Hayden
Stanford Professor of Quantum Physics and Professor, by courtesy, of Computer Science
BioProfessor Hayden is a leader in the exciting new field of quantum information science. He has contributed greatly to our understanding of the absolute limits that quantum mechanics places on information processing, and how to exploit quantum effects for computing and other aspects of communication. He has also made some key insights on the relationship between black holes and information theory.

Gabrielle Hecht
Stanton Foundation Professor of Nuclear Security and Senior Fellow at the Freeman Spogli Institute for International Studies
BioGabrielle Hecht is the Frank Stanton Foundation Professor of Nuclear Security at CISAC, Senior Fellow at FSI, Professor of History, and Professor (by courtesy) of Anthropology.
Her current research explores radioactive residues, mine waste, air pollution, and the Anthropocene in Africa. These interests are coalescing into a series of essays, provisionally titled Inside-Out Earth: Residual Governance Under Extreme Conditions. The first of these have appeared in Cultural Anthropology, Aeon, Somatosphere, the LA Review of Books, and e-fluxArchitecture.
Hecht's graduate courses include colloquia on Infrastructure and Power in the Global South, Technopolitics, and Materiality and Power. In Winter 2020 she developed a community-engaged undergraduate research seminar on Nuclear Insecurity in the Bay Area and Beyond, in partnership with the Bayview Hunters Point Community Advocates (BVHPCA). She is currently working with BVHPCA and other partners to develop knowledge infrastructures to underpin community-driven public history that supports racial equity and environmental justice.
Hecht’s 2012 book Being Nuclear: Africans and the Global Uranium Trade offers new perspectives on the global nuclear order by focusing on African uranium mines and miners. It received awards from the Society for the Social Studies of Science, the American Historical Association, the American Sociological Association, and the Suzanne M. Glasscock Humanities Institute, as well as an honorable mention from the African Studies Association. An abridged version appeared in French as Uranium Africain, une histoire globale (Le Seuil 2016), and a Japanese translation is due out in 2021. Her first book, The Radiance of France: Nuclear Power and National Identity (1998/ 2nd ed 2009), explores how the French embedded nuclear policy in reactor technology, and nuclear culture in reactor operations. It received awards from the American Historical Association and the Society for the History of Technology, and has appeared in French as Le rayonnement de la France: Énergie nucléaire et identité nationale après la seconde guerre mondiale (2004/ 2014).
Her affiliations at Stanford include the Center for African Studies, the Program in Science, Technology, and Society, the Center for Global Ethnography, the Program on Urban Studies, and the Program in Modern Thought and Literature. Before rejoining Stanford in 2017, Hecht taught at the University of Michigan’s History department for eighteen years. She helped to found and direct UM’s Program in Science, Technology, and Society (STS). She served as associate director of UM’s African Studies Center, and participated in its long-term collaboration with the Wits Institute for Social and Economic Research (South Africa). She has supervised dissertations in STS, African history and anthropology, nuclear studies, and French history.
Hecht holds a PhD in History and Sociology of Science from the University of Pennsylvania (1992), and a bachelor’s degree in Physics from MIT (1986). She’s been a visiting scholar in universities in Australia, France, the Netherlands, Norway, South Africa, and Sweden. Her work has been funded by the National Science Foundation, the National Endowment for the Humanities, the American Council for Learned Societies, and the South African and Dutch national research foundations, among others. She serves on numerous advisory boards, including for the Andra, France’s national radioactive waste management agency. -

Martin Hellman
Professor of Electrical Engineering, Emeritus
BioMartin E. Hellman is Professor Emeritus of Electrical Engineering at Stanford University and is affiliated with the university's Center for International Security and Cooperation (CISAC). His most recent work, "Rethinking National Security," identifies a number of questionable assumptions that are largely taken as axiomatic truths. A key part of that work brings a risk informed framework to a potential failure of nuclear deterrence and then finds surprising ways to reduce the risk. His earlier work included co-inventing public key cryptography, the technology that underlies the secure portion of the Internet. His many honors include election to the National Academy of Engineering and receiving (jointly with his colleague Whit Diffie) the million dollar ACM Turing Award, the top prize in computer science. In 2016, he and his wife of fifty years published "A New Map for Relationships: Creating True Love at Home & Peace on the Planet," providing a “unified field theory” for peace by illuminating the connections between nuclear war, conventional war, interpersonal war, and war within our own psyches.

Pamela Hinds
Professor of Management Science and Engineering
BioPamela J. Hinds is Fortinet Founders Chair and Professor of Management Science & Engineering, Co-Director of the Center on Work, Technology, and Organization and on the Director's Council for the Hasso Plattner Institute of Design.. She studies the effect of technology on teams, collaboration, and innovation. Pamela has conducted extensive research on the dynamics of cross-boundary work teams, particularly those spanning national borders. She explores issues of culture, language, identity, conflict, and the role of site visits in promoting knowledge sharing and collaboration. She has published extensively on the relationship between national culture and work practices, particularly exploring how work practices or technologies created in one location are understood and employed at distant sites. Pamela also has a body of research on human-robot interaction in the work environment and the dynamics of human-robot teams. Most recently, Pamela has been looking at the changing nature of work in the face of emerging technologies, including the nature of coordination in open innovation, changes in work and organizing resulting from 3D-printing, and the work of data analysts. Her research has appeared in journals such as Organization Science, Research in Organizational Behavior, Academy of Management Journal, Academy of Management Annals, Academy of Management Discoveries, Human-Computer Interaction, Journal of Applied Psychology, Journal of Experimental Psychology: Applied, and Organizational Behavior and Human Decision Processes. Pamela is a Senior Editor of Organization Science. She is also co-editor with Sara Kiesler of the book Distributed Work (MIT Press). Pamela holds a Ph.D. in Organizational Science and Management from Carnegie Mellon University.

Stephen Hinton
Avalon Foundation Professor in the Humanities and Professor, by courtesy, of German Studies
BioSpecial fields: aesthetics, history of theory, music of Weill, Hindemith and Beethoven.
Stephen Hinton is the Avalon Foundation Professor in the Humanities at Stanford University, Professor of Music and, by courtesy, of German. From 2011-15 he served as the Denning Family Director of the Stanford Arts Institute. From 2006–2010 he was Senior Associate Dean for Humanities & Arts, and from 1997–2004 chairman of the Department of Music. Before moving to Stanford, he taught at Yale University and, before that, at the Technische Universität Berlin. His publications include The Idea of Gebrauchsmusik; Kurt Weill: The Threepenny Opera for the series Cambridge Opera Handbooks; the critical edition of Die Dreigroschenoper for the Kurt Weill Edition (edited with Edward Harsh); Kurt Weill, Gesammelte Schriften (Collected Writings, edited with Jürgen Schebera, and issued in 2000 in an expanded second edition); and the edition of the Symphony Mathis der Maler for Paul Hindemith’s Collected Works.
He has published widely on many aspects of modern German music history and theory, with contributions to publications such as Handwörterbuch der musikalischen Terminologie, New Grove Dictionary of Music and Musicians, Musik in Geschichte und Gegenwart, and Funkkolleg Musikgeschichte. He has also served as editor of the journal Beethoven Forum. Recent articles include “The Emancipation of Dissonance: Schoenberg’s Two Practices of Composition” (Music & Letters, 2010) and “Schoenberg’s Harmonielehre: Psychology and Comprehensibility” (Tonality 1900-1950: Concept and Practice). His book Weill’s Musical Theater: Stages of Reform, the first musicological study of Kurt Weill’s complete stage works, won the 2013 Kurt Weill Prize for distinguished scholarship in musical theater. Together with the St. Lawrence String Quartet, he produced the series of online courses called Defining the String Quartet focusing on the music of Haydn (2016) and Beethoven (2019). -

Ian Hodder
Dunlevie Family Professor and Professor, by courtesy, of Classics
BioIan Hodder joined the Department of Cultural and Social Anthropology in September of 1999. Among his publications are: Symbols in Action (Cambridge 1982), Reading the Past (Cambridge 1986), The Domestication of Europe (Oxford 1990), The Archaeological Process (Oxford 1999). Catalhoyuk: The Leopard's Tale (Thames and Hudson 2006), and Entangled. An archaeology of the relationships between humans and things (Wiley and Blackwell, 2012). Professor Hodder has been conducting the excavation of the 9,000 year-old Neolithic site of Catalhoyuk in central Turkey since 1993. The 25-year project has three aims - to place the art from the site in its full environmental, economic and social context, to conserve the paintings, plasters and mud walls, and to present the site to the public. The project is also associated with attempts to develop reflexive methods in archaeology. Dr. Hodder is currently the Dunlevie Family Professor.

Keith Hodgson
David Mulvane Ehrsam and Edward Curtis Franklin Professor of Chemistry and Professor of Photon Science at SLAC
BioCombining inorganic, biophysical and structural chemistry, Professor Keith Hodgson investigates how structure at molecular and macromolecular levels relates to function. Studies in the Hodgson lab have pioneered the use of synchrotron x-radiation to probe the electronic and structural environment of biomolecules. Recent efforts focus on the applications of x-ray diffraction, scattering and absorption spectroscopy to examine metalloproteins that are important in Earth’s biosphere, such as those that convert nitrogen to ammonia or methane to methanol.
Keith O. Hodgson was born in Virginia in 1947. He studied chemistry at the University of Virginia (B.S. 1969) and University of California, Berkeley (Ph.D. 1972), with a postdoctoral year at the ETH in Zurich. He joined the Stanford Chemistry Department faculty in 1973, starting up a program of fundamental research into the use of x-rays to study chemical and biological structure that made use of the unique capabilities of the Stanford Synchrotron Radiation Lightsource (SSRL). His lab carried out pioneering x-ray absorption and x-ray crystallographic studies of proteins, laying the foundation for a new field now in broad use worldwide. In the early eighties, he began development of one of the world's first synchrotron-based structural molecular biology research and user programs, centered at SSRL. He served as SSRL Director from 1998 to 2005, and SLAC National Accelerator Laboratory (SLAC) Deputy Director (2005-2007) and Associate Laboratory Director for Photon Science (2007-2011).
Today the Hodgson research group investigates how molecular structure at different organizational levels relates to biological and chemical function, using a variety of x-ray absorption, diffraction and scattering techniques. Typical of these molecular structural studies are investigations of metal ions as active sites of biomolecules. His research group develops and utilizes techniques such as x-ray absorption and emission spectroscopy (XAS and XES) to study the electronic and metrical details of a given metal ion in the biomolecule under a variety of natural conditions.
A major area of focus over many years, the active site of the enzyme nitrogenase is responsible for conversion of atmospheric di-nitrogen to ammonia. Using XAS studies at the S, Fe and Mo edge, the Hodgson group has worked to understand the electronic structure as a function of redox in this cluster. They have developed new methods to study long distances in the cluster within and outside the protein. Studies are ongoing to learn how this cluster functions during catalysis and interacts with substrates and inhibitors. Other components of the protein are also under active study.
Additional projects include the study of iron in dioxygen activation and oxidation within the binuclear iron-containing enzyme methane monooxygenase and in cytochrome oxidase. Lab members are also investigating the role of copper in electron transport and in dioxygen activation. Other studies include the electronic structure of iron-sulfur clusters in models and enzymes.
The research group is also focusing on using the next generation of x-ray light sources, the free electron laser. Such a light source, called the LCLS, is also located at SLAC. They are also developing new approaches using x-ray free electron laser radiation to image noncrystalline biomolecules and study chemical reactivity on ultrafast time scales.
